The past few decades have witnessed a steady increase in the number of programmes to combat bullying that have been developed and tested in school settings. But how well do they work? What does the research tell us?
The Swedish National Council for Crime Prevention (Brå) has initiated the publication of a series of systematic reviews, in the context of which renowned researchers are commissioned to perform the studies on our behalf. In this study, the authors have carried out a systematic review, including a meta-analysis, of 59 scientific evaluations of anti-bullying programs from different parts of the world.
Maria M. Ttofi is a PhD Candidate at the Institute of Criminology, Cambridge University
David P. Farrington is Professor of Psychological Criminology at the Institute of Criminology, Cambridge University
Anna C. Baldry is Associate Professor of Social Psychology, Second University of Naples, and Senior Researcher, Intervict, Tilburg University, The Netherlands
